rounding is unbiased, except on the ADSP-217x, ADSP-218x, and ADSP-
21msp58/59 processors, which offer a biased rounding mode. For a
discussion of biased vs. unbiased rounding, see “Rounding Mode” in the
“Multiplier/Accumulator” section of Chapter 2, Computation Units.
Status Generated:
ASTAT: 7 6 5 43210
SS MV AQ AS AC AV AN AZ
*–––––
MV Set on MAC overflow (if any of upper 9 bits of MR are not
all one or zero). Cleared otherwise.
